Twilight Tour of the Parramatta Female Factory

  • 5 Sep 2023
  • 16:30 - 17:30
  • Parramatta Female Factory 5 Fleet Street North Parramatta, NSW 2151


Guided Tour


The Parramatta Female Factory Friends are offering a twilight tour of the Parramatta Female Factory with expert guides at 4.30 pm to 5.30 pm. This gives you a chance to see the magnificent national heritage buildings against the backdrop of a setting sun and the glow of the sandstone. The tour will unfold the story of the Factory and what life was like for a female convict.

The tour will finish up just in time to attend the HCNSW's Annual History Lecture held in the same precinct at the WSSH, also known as The Main Kitchen.
